The lymphatic system collects fluid that has leaked from blood capillaries,removes bacteria,and returns the cleansed fluid to the blood.
Trabeculae Carnea
A series of muscular ridges found inside the ventricles of the heart, contributing to the heart's contractile force.
Epicardium
The outermost layer of the heart wall composed of connective tissue and fat, serving as a protective layer.
Parietal Pericardium
The outer fibrous layer of the pericardium, a double-walled sac containing the heart and the roots of the major blood vessels.
